Agricultural Equipment & Supplies in Indianapolis, IN
2 N Meridian St, Ste 1, Indianapolis, Indiana, 46204-3010
(317) 636-7599
7540 Brookville Rd, Indianapolis, Indiana, 46239-1092
(317) 375-1735
1730 W Michigan St, Indianapolis, Indiana, 46222-3855
(317) 632-1481
8800 Brookville Rd, Indianapolis, Indiana, 46239
(317) 591-9100
4931 Robison Rd, Indianapolis, Indiana, 46268
(317) 228-4900
8135 Brookville Rd, Indianapolis, Indiana, 46239-8907
(317) 353-8056